Classic White Shiplap IslandA classic white shiplap kitchen island can bring a fresh, clean look to your kitchen. Pair it with a dark countertop for contrast, and don’t forget about the stylish bar stools! You can even add some decorative elements like hanging lights or a centerpiece to make it pop.2. Colorful Shiplap AccentsWho says shiplap has to be white? Consider using colored shiplap for a bold statement. Shades like navy blue or sage green can add personality to your island. This is a fantastic way to incorporate your favorite color while maintaining a chic look. Think about how this can tie in with your existing kitchen color scheme!3. Mixed Materials for TextureCombine shiplap with other materials like wood or metal for a unique, textured kitchen island. For example, a shiplap base with a granite or butcher block top can create a stunning focal point. This blend of textures adds depth and interest, making your kitchen feel more dynamic.4. Functional Shiplap IslandsShiplap isn’t just for looks! Consider designing a functional kitchen island that includes storage solutions. Shelves or cabinets can be hidden behind shiplap paneling, keeping your kitchen organized while looking beautiful. This practical approach means you can have the best of both worlds!5. Not only is this a fun project, but it also allows you to customize your island to fit your unique style.FAQWhat is shiplap? Shiplap is a type of wooden board that is commonly used for siding and interior applications. Its overlapping design creates a distinctive look.Can I use shiplap in a small kitchen? Absolutely! Shiplap can enhance the coziness of a small kitchen, making it feel more inviting.welcome to CoohomHome Design for FreePlease check with customer service before testing new feature.
